Who We Are
North American Lighting Inc., member of the Koito Group of Companies, is the largest tier one automotive exterior lighting manufacturer in North America. As the market share leader in exterior automotive lighting, NAL provides advanced lighting technology, engineering design expertise, and state-of-the-art production capabilities to auto makers based in North America and around the world.
Our Opportunity
North American Lighting (NAL) is looking for a Production Control Manager to join our team. The ideal candidate will plan, direct, and manage all Production Control functions and personnel in the plant, ensuring the efficient and timely flow of materials and parts between or within departments.
Essential Duties & Responsibilities
Your Priorities
Supervises, establishes, and coordinates the production schedules within the plant, including purchased material and manufactured parts, based on customer requirements and forecast.
Maintains required Kanban card level within production system to meet production schedule.
Acts to eliminate delays and ensures adherence to production and shipping requirements.
Works closely with the Purchasing Department to ensure proper flow of purchased material.
Maintains and monitors inventory levels, turns, and accuracy.
Ensures effective support of production, shipping, customer service, and engineering, as needed.
Requirements
Your Background
Bachelor’s Degree in Business, Manufacturing, or a related discipline, plus 8 - 10 years of experience in production control—including:
3 years of experience in a lead or supervisory role.
Experience working in a JIT manufacturing environment utilizing Kanban.
Continuous improvement or Kaizen experience.
APICS Certification is preferred.
